Geospatial analytics experts convened at UM6P-MIT climate monitoring workshop
On the 19th of May, the Center for Remote Sensing Applications (CRSA), in collaborations with MIT's Department of Earth, Atmospheric and Planetary Sciences, organized a Workshop on Earth Observation for Assessing Climate Impacts Across Africa at UM6P Campus in Benguerir.
The event was part of the African Geospatial Data Portal Framework for Science, Capacity-Building, and Decision-Making Purposes (AfEOP) project. The list of speakers included professors and experts from MIT, University of Valencia, French National institute for Agricultural, food and Environmental Research (INRAE), Paris-Est Sup, and the Institute of Research for Development. The workshop hosted Participants from universities in Tunisia, Senegal, Burkina Faso, and Morocco.
